Beschreibung

The sinc function is well known in people and have many interesting properties. These mathematical properties are well known in electrical engineers & physicists and used in many domains like signal processing.Since C.Stormer introduced his paper about those in 1885, many properties on sinc has been studied, generalized and results of these studies are introduced in preferences.This book is written to organize and explain the things of these properties which are studied much than others. In chapter 1, we introduce the fundamental knowledge which you need in order to understand chapter 2 and chapter 3. Here, an introduction to the series, derivative and integral of functions, Fourier transform, and our main objective, sinc function are presented.Chapter 2 describes computational methods and properties such as monotonicity, convergence of functional sequence whose integrand is a function of singular integrals, exactly what is the integral of the product of the sinc function. In the previous section of Chapter 2, we describe the uniform continuity of the sinc function.In chapter 3, we compute the sinc integral in our new and interesting way, with the method of using Fourier transform.
